“Homosexuality: “natural” or chosen?

What does the Bible have to say about the claim of many homosexuals today that one’s sexual preference is “natural” and not chosen? Are we born with one tendency over the other? What is the cause of homosexuality?

Several factors must be kept in mind here, the first of which is the most basic: God condemns homosexuality. The Scriptures allow no mitigating circumstances but everywhere treats homosexuality as unnatural and sinful. See, for example, Leviticus 18:22, 24; 20:13; Romans 1:18-32; and 1 Corinthians 6:9-10. These passages of Scripture, and others like them, establish at least these three conclusions:

1) Homosexuality is rebellion against God.  There is no way to speak of any kind of acceptable or “Christian” homosexuality.  There is never any allowance for it, and it is never anything but sinful.
